Definition of rusticates:

(v) : (transitive) To compel to live in or to send to the countryside; to cause to become rustic.
(v) : (intransitive) To go to reside in the country.
(v) : (transitive) To construct so as to produce jagged or heavily textured surfaces.
(v) : (ambitransitive, Oxbridge, Durham University) To be suspended or expelled temporarily from the university, either compulsorily or voluntarily.
